Transaction 2e7f3aad20e58d0bd28c803e6a8a198f6d22d49dd24ce323dfe9a7b119521977
1 Input
2 Outputs
- 2e7f3aad20e58d0bd28c803e6a8a198f6d22d49dd24ce323dfe9a7b119521977:0
- 2e7f3aad20e58d0bd28c803e6a8a198f6d22d49dd24ce323dfe9a7b119521977:1
value 15338836
address 1FurRZXf3dCGWgHrgeeDgsX4p6P6hRPaEP
value 2984653940
address 1SurBqvoK1KK55Zs9pqHVWejY75PVeb7F